First Stop: Phu Pha Sawan Waterfall – A Refreshing Nature Escape

Your first destination is the newly opened Phu Pha Sawan Waterfall. Located in Thai Mueang District, this medium-sized waterfall is around 60 meters high and offers a surprisingly accessible nature escape. Unlike more remote waterfalls that require intense hikes, Phu Pha Sawan is developed to be easily reachable, making it suitable for most fitness levels.

What makes this stop stand out is the clear, cool pools where you can dip your feet or even enjoy a quick swim. Several reviewers, like Valérie from France, mention how much they appreciated the opportunity to relax in the pristine water after the drive. She describes the activity as “convivial and very friendly,” noting the guide’s wife Aommy’s excellent photo-taking skills.

The Na Tei Subdistrict Administrative Organization’s development efforts have clearly paid off, turning this waterfall into a local treasure. It’s a great chance to enjoy nature without the strenuous hikes often associated with waterfalls—and the water temperature is just right for a cooling break.

Second Stop: Samet Nangshe Viewpoint – A Breathtaking Panorama

After soaking up the serenity of the waterfall, the journey continues to Samet Nangshe Viewpoint in Takua Thung District. This spot has earned praise for providing some of the most impressive views of Phang Nga Bay. You’ll get a perspective that’s often missed, with limestone karsts rising dramatically from the water and a vast mangrove forest framing the scene.

The viewpoint isn’t just a pretty picture—many reviews highlight how guides like Jo and Aommy make the experience more meaningful. Valérie mentions how Jo expertly takes photos during the visit, capturing memories of the stunning scenery, and how the guides’ friendly manner made the trip feel like hanging out with friends.
